iPhone app digitizes student ID, informs UK students of deals and discounts

Student Beans ID is a new iOS app designed for college students seeking to use their campus ID for student discounts. The app acts as a digital student ID, enabling users to discover and access thousands of student discounts in and around campus.

Students simply flash a verified Student Beans ID on their smart phone to prove student status to receive the discounts. Students can also use the app to discover local bars, restaurants and other student-friendly gems, with the locations displayed on a map or in a list. The app is free to use and promises no in-app advertisements.

Student Beans is a university lifestyle brand. The app is free to download and offers an alternative to traditional student discount cards that can cost up to £10. Students can claim discounts in shops, restaurants and entertainment venues as well as discover new locations offering student discounts in their local area. The app displays redeem codes directly on the phone’s screen, for the student to use in the store or restaurant.

The app, which is available on the Apple App Store, has amassed more than 5,000 discount venues across the UK, spanning both national chains and local businesses including Jack Wills, Zizzi, French Connection, La Tasca, Cineworld, O2, New Look, Hotel Chocolat, Urban Outfitters and Krispy Kreme. More venues are being added to the app daily.
